How to Repair double glazing repairs near me Glazing

Double glazed windows are long-lasting and secure, but they will wear and tear over time. Double glazing that is in need of repair can be detected by the feeling of draught between the window panes or condensation.

Fogging or condensation between the panes typically indicates that the seal holding the glass panes together has been broken. This can be fixed with the reseal.

Seals

The seals that are used in double glazing are an important element of the overall insulation and energy efficiency of windows. They are placed between the glass panes of uPVC frames and provide an airtight shield that helps to keep out wind and rain drafts, condensation and drafts which can cause damp on walls and window sills. In addition, the window seals help to keep warm air inside and cold air out, which significantly lowers heating costs.

It is not uncommon for window seals to develop defects. This is typically due to exposure to harsh weather conditions and extreme elements such as high winds rain and snow. However, it can also be due to improper installation or the use of chemicals like paint strippers that harm the rubber.

If the window seals fail, it could result in moisture and humidity may seep through the glass panes, causing fogging or misting of the windows. It can affect the insulation properties of double glazing because it won't have the inert gas between the panes, which assists in retaining heat.

Glass

Double glazing can have problems. The most frequent issue is misting, which occurs when the seal between two panes fails and moisture collects. Fortunately, misted double glazing can be repaired without the cost of replacing the entire window. The process of repairing it involves removing the damaged pane, blowing air through the gap to eliminate any lingering moisture and creating a new seal.

Double glazed windows can be made from a variety of glass. Some of the glass is a plain type, similar to mirrors or safety, however it is tempered for durability and safety. Other kinds of glass are coated to improve their properties. This could include solar control glass which reduces glare and stops heat transfer; extra-clean glass, which is stain-resistant and self-cleaning and the chromogenic glass, which alters transparency based on temperature.

Double-glazed units that have high efficiency are also available from a few manufacturers. These units use insulated glass and special films to maintain the internal temperature so that heating and cooling systems don't have to be as laborious.

They are typically an affordable alternative to replacing windows, and they can save you a lot of energy. However, these units do require proper maintenance because the technology they use can become worn out over time.

Locks

A reliable tradesperson will put a lock on your window regardless of whether you're installing new windows or repairing double glazing. In the course of quoting, your installer should discuss the different locking systems available and which one best fits your needs and local crime rate. An extremely popular choice is an Espagnolette system, which is comprised of bolts with a mushroom-shaped head that fit behind locking points on the frame. They are commonly used in uPVC doors and windows but can be added to aluminum and timber.

Other locks are made to limit the amount of opening a window. Consider installing a Canzak Window Restriction cable in your casement window. It works like a door chain lock that can be put on either side of the opening to prevent it from opening up too much. It's also very easy to install and is among the few locks that can be used on casements.

For sash windows with hinges, a hinged wedge lock is an easy fix to stop the lower sash from rising enough to let an intruder enter. Cut an sash of wood that is the length of the channel used to operate the lower sash. Install it and tack it on the wall.

You can also put in the sash lock or a casement lock. These are stronger than latch locks, and are typically used in conjunction with them to secure windows. They are found on the side of a window and are used on double and single hanging windows as well as sliding windows.

Other ways to increase the security of your double-glazed windows include installing the shoot bolt lock system. These locks are made by bolts that are shot from both ends to create a sturdy lock. They are usually offered as an upgrade and are suitable for both commercial and domestic use.
